The mathematics question will be quite popular, but it won’t differ from problems that have already been given. The exam will now be broken into two sections.
A maximum of 50 questions will be asked in the OBJ part of the WAEC Mathematics Paper 1 (also known as Section One). Each answer is worth one mark.

Instructions for the WAEC Mathematics Examination
It is against the rules to begin opening your exam questions before the exam has begun.
In the OBJ section, use HB pencil throughout, and in the theoretical section, use a pen or biro.
Be very careful because getting caught with expo could result in WAEC withholding your results.
Remember to put your name, exam number, and center number first before any other information.
Math is what this is. Never fail to bring a calculator into the hallway.
Before submitting, check to see if the pieces you have already written are free of errors.
